i have a pond and i use a walk-behind brush mower; that can only get so close. then i use a weed wacker with a three point blade. i'll do this about every 4-8 weeks. BUT once i start the weed wacking my lower back starts screaming (hurting) at me.

what is the best way to trim around a pond? i have a tractor should i invest in a sickle mower?

what is the best way to trim around a pond? i have a tractor should i invest in a sickle mower?

A sickle mower would work if the blade is longer enough. You would want to be very careful with a tractor around a pond. Always keep the wheels off the slope. Another possibility is a boom mower but they are expensive and you need a fairly large tractor. Would a goat be feasible where you live? My finish mower hangs on my 3ph, and I just back up until the rear wheels of the mower deck drop into the pond, and just pull forward. Takes a while doing it 5 feet at a time.

We have a similar situation around our pond. I let my teenage son weedeat it. I have sprayed a half normal strength solution of roundup to stunt the vegetation. On the smooth slope going to the water we can use the zero turn mower to back down and mow up the slope. To get real close to the water we tie a strap to the zero turn and back down just to the edge the other end is tied to our mule just in case. It takes teamwork but the last solution looks the best and only takes a few minutes.

I use a " ditch mower" which consists of an old Craftsman 21" push mower with the large rear wheels and a second set of handles welded to it, this allows me to have almost 10' of reach. I got the idea when an old guy up the street asked me to build one for him to do his ditches.

Each and every pond is different. I have a two acre pond with firm banks and I use the finishing mower and get as close as possible and then I found that if you have a good weed eater with shoulder harness is the trick. When I say good weed eater I have an easy start echo (in my opinion none better) It is one quick mowing weed eater. This works for me and I have a bad back and 75 years of age.
